Replacing an ac unit expenses between $2,500 and $15,000 for a central unit, consisting of setup. However, a/c are much cheaper to repair than to replace. You may require to change your system if you increase its age in years by the estimated fixing expenses and the result is greater than $5,000 (home ac repair).


The repair is greater than 50% of the device's purchase price. The device damages down frequently. The unit is greater than 12 years of ages. The device still utilizes R-22 freon, an eco damaging chemical banned in 2020. Your power bills are enhancing, and you desire a more reliable system. In many air-conditioning systems, the condenser unit lies outside your house and is prone to collect dirt and debris from trees, yard mowing, and airborne dust. The condenser has a fan that moves air across the condenser coil. You need to clean the coil on the intake side, so, before you switch off the power to the air conditioner, check to see which instructions the air relocates across the coils.

About American Energy Heat & Air

Action 2: Clean condenser with business coil cleaner, offered at fridge supply shops. Directions for usage are included. Flush coil clean (do not use hose); let dry. Action 3: Tidy fins with soft brush to get rid of collected dust. You might need to eliminate safety grille to reach them. Do unclean fins with yard tube, as water can turn dirt right into mud and small it between fins.

If fins are bent, align them with fin comb, offered at many home appliance parts stores. A fin comb is developed to slide right into spaces in between fins. Use it meticulously to avoid harmful fins. Step 4: Inspect concrete pad on which condenser rests to make certain it's level. Set woodworkers' degree front to back and side to side on top of unit.

1/ 8 Family Handyman Central home air conditioner service systems are composed of two significant parts: a condenser that sits outside your home and the evaporator coil (commonly referred to as an A-coil) that rests in the plenum of your furnace or air trainer. https://securecc.smartinsight.co/profile/14699757/AmericanEnergyHeatAir. The cooling agent in the A-coil gets the warm from your home and relocate to the exterior condensing device

Facts About American Energy Heat & Air Revealed

The condensing unit houses the three parts replaceable by a DIYer: the AC contactor, the start/run capacitor(s) and the condenser fan motor. The condensing system additionally houses the compressor, however only a pro can change that. The A-coil has no components that can be serviced by a DIYer. WARNING: Discharge the capacitor before separating cords or removing it from its brace. 7/ 8 Household Handyman An AC contactor is a $25 mechanical relay that uses low-voltage power from the thermostat to switch 220-volt high-amperage current to the compressor and condenser follower.

Also if your Air conditioner contactor is working, it pays to change it every five years or so. Loosen the old Air conditioner contactor prior to getting rid of the cables.

Protect the brand-new contactor in the condensing system. 8/ 8 Family Handyman Reinstall the gain access to panel and detach block. Activate the breaker and heating system button, then established the thermostat to a lower temperature and wait on the air conditioning to start. The compressor should run and the condenser fan ought to spin.
